#include <AssembleContinuityElemSolverAlgorithm.h>
|
| void | apply_coeff (const std::vector< stk::mesh::Entity > &sym_meshobj, std::vector< int > &scratchIds, std::vector< double > &scratchVals, const std::vector< double > &rhs, const std::vector< double > &lhs, const char *trace_tag=0) |
| |
| void | apply_coeff (unsigned numMeshobjs, const stk::mesh::Entity *symMeshobjs, const SharedMemView< int * > &scratchIds, const SharedMemView< int * > &sortPermutation, const SharedMemView< const double * > &rhs, const SharedMemView< const double ** > &lhs, const char *trace_tag) |
| |
| EquationSystem * | eqSystem_ |
| |
| sierra::nalu::AssembleContinuityElemSolverAlgorithm::AssembleContinuityElemSolverAlgorithm |
( |
Realm & |
realm, |
|
|
stk::mesh::Part * |
part, |
|
|
EquationSystem * |
eqSystem |
|
) |
| |
| virtual sierra::nalu::AssembleContinuityElemSolverAlgorithm::~AssembleContinuityElemSolverAlgorithm |
( |
| ) |
|
|
inlinevirtual |
| void sierra::nalu::AssembleContinuityElemSolverAlgorithm::execute |
( |
| ) |
|
|
virtual |
Implements sierra::nalu::SolverAlgorithm.
References sierra::nalu::MasterElement::adjacentNodes(), sierra::nalu::SolverAlgorithm::apply_coeff(), coordinates_, density_, sierra::nalu::MasterElement::determinant(), sierra::nalu::Realm::get_buckets(), sierra::nalu::Realm::get_gamma1(), sierra::nalu::Realm::get_inactive_selector(), sierra::nalu::Realm::get_mdot_interp(), sierra::nalu::MasterElementRepo::get_surface_master_element(), sierra::nalu::Realm::get_time_step(), sierra::nalu::MasterElementRepo::get_volume_master_element(), Gpdx_, sierra::nalu::MasterElement::grad_op(), anonymous_namespace{UnitTestContinuityAdvElem.C}::hex8_golds::advection_default::lhs, sierra::nalu::Realm::meta_data(), sierra::nalu::MasterElement::nodesPerElement_, sierra::nalu::MasterElement::numIntPoints_, sierra::nalu::Algorithm::partVec_, pressure_, sierra::nalu::Algorithm::realm_, reducedSensitivities_, anonymous_namespace{UnitTestContinuityAdvElem.C}::hex8_golds::advection_default::rhs, sierra::nalu::MasterElement::shape_fcn(), sierra::nalu::MasterElement::shifted_grad_op(), sierra::nalu::MasterElement::shifted_shape_fcn(), shiftMdot_, shiftPoisson_, sierra::nalu::Algorithm::supplementalAlg_, and velocityRTM_.
| void sierra::nalu::AssembleContinuityElemSolverAlgorithm::initialize_connectivity |
( |
| ) |
|
|
virtual |
| VectorFieldType* sierra::nalu::AssembleContinuityElemSolverAlgorithm::coordinates_ |
| ScalarFieldType* sierra::nalu::AssembleContinuityElemSolverAlgorithm::density_ |
| VectorFieldType* sierra::nalu::AssembleContinuityElemSolverAlgorithm::Gpdx_ |
| const bool sierra::nalu::AssembleContinuityElemSolverAlgorithm::meshMotion_ |
| ScalarFieldType* sierra::nalu::AssembleContinuityElemSolverAlgorithm::pressure_ |
| const bool sierra::nalu::AssembleContinuityElemSolverAlgorithm::reducedSensitivities_ |
| const bool sierra::nalu::AssembleContinuityElemSolverAlgorithm::shiftMdot_ |
| const bool sierra::nalu::AssembleContinuityElemSolverAlgorithm::shiftPoisson_ |
| VectorFieldType* sierra::nalu::AssembleContinuityElemSolverAlgorithm::velocityRTM_ |
The documentation for this class was generated from the following files: